Pre-Calculus Trigonometry
University of Alabama at Birmingham
CourseMA 106
Trigonometric functions and their inverses, graphs, and properties; right triangle trigonometry and applications; analytical trigonometry, trigonometric identities and equations; polar coordinates; vectors; laws of sines and cosines; conic sections. Supports development of quantitative literacy. Quantitative Literacy is a significant component of this course.
